slow down your check and changing to many things at once.
you ever mentioned how she idles ? steady? fluctuation ? popping ? smoking? white or black smoke present? these are tell tail signs
make a check list and eliminate as you go ! air , fuel , spark.
1. did you do the valve adjustment ? if you have a tight valve that could cause all kinds of problems
2. make sure your fuel flow is clean and steady! new filter and pump and is working right.
3. now if she idles right after valves are check / correctly shimmed.... you can move onto timing and throttle body sync.
you said you did the gas check for leaks and it didnt show leaks. leave that alone for a sec. just work on idle .
once thats right you can chase down the other issue.
1. mass airflow sensor ( could be stuck or a faulty unit) or just needs to be adjusted . there are articles here that walk you thought it .
2.ECU maybe a bad unit or a short ( probably not )
3.throttle position switch could be a culprit .
